资源说明:标题中的"ant-jmf-1.6.jar.zip"是一个压缩文件,它包含了两个主要元素:一个名为"ant-jmf-1.6.jar"的Java Archive(JAR)文件和一个"ant.license.txt"的文本文件。这个压缩包主要用于软件开发,特别是与Apache Ant和Java Media Framework(JMF)相关的项目。
**Apache Ant** 是一个开源的Java构建工具,它被广泛用于自动化Java应用程序的构建、测试和部署过程。Ant基于XML来定义任务,这些任务可以包括编译源代码、打包JAR文件、运行测试等。Ant的主要优点是它的可配置性和跨平台性,使得开发者能够根据项目的具体需求定制构建流程。
**Java Media Framework (JMF)** 是一个用于开发和播放多媒体内容的Java API。JMF支持音频、视频的捕获、处理和播放,适用于创建各种多媒体应用,如视频会议、流媒体服务器等。JMF提供了处理多媒体数据的能力,但它的功能可能在某些现代操作系统上有限,因为许多现代系统已经内置了更强大的多媒体处理框架。
"ant-jmf-1.6.jar"很可能是一个包含Ant扩展或任务的库,专门为集成JMF到Ant构建过程设计。这个JAR文件可能是由开发者为了简化在Ant构建脚本中处理JMF相关任务而创建的。它可能包含了一些自定义的任务或者对JMF的包装,使得Ant可以在构建过程中调用JMF的功能,例如编译JMF相关的源代码,打包多媒体应用,或者进行JMF特定的测试。
"ant.license.txt"文件通常包含关于Ant库的许可信息,可能包括Apache Software License的版本,该许可证通常允许自由使用、修改和分发开源软件。开发者在使用这些库时,必须遵循这些许可条款,尊重版权并确保合规性。
总结来说,这个"ant-jmf-1.6.jar.zip"压缩包是为Java开发人员准备的,他们可能正在使用Apache Ant构建包含JMF组件的项目。压缩包中的"ant-jmf-1.6.jar"提供了Ant与JMF的接口,使得构建过程能够无缝集成多媒体处理能力,而"ant.license.txt"则明确了库的使用权限和条件。在使用这个压缩包时,开发人员需要解压文件,将"ant-jmf-1.6.jar"添加到Ant构建路径中,并参考"ant.license.txt"了解使用限制。
本源码包内暂不包含可直接显示的源代码文件,请下载源码包。